2001 Darrell Hammond

Manny Ceneta / AFP / Getty
Saturday Night Live's ace impressionist gets the gig for the first dinner of the Bush era. A shrewd choice: points for hipness, but no risk of real embarrassment, as Hammond does takeoffs of Bill Clinton and Al Gore but thoughtfully avoids the newly elected President. Bush contributes his own jokey slide show of the family and makes cracks about the 2000 election recount. Even Democrats are detected laughing.
